We use these services and cookies to improve your user experience. You may opt out if you wish, however, this may limit some features on this site.

Please see our statement on Data Privacy.

Crisp.chat (Helpdesk and Chat)

Ok

THREATINT
PUBLISHED

CVE-2025-22120

ext4: goto right label 'out_mmap_sem' in ext4_setattr()



Description

In the Linux kernel, the following vulnerability has been resolved: ext4: goto right label 'out_mmap_sem' in ext4_setattr() Otherwise, if ext4_inode_attach_jinode() fails, a hung task will happen because filemap_invalidate_unlock() isn't called to unlock mapping->invalidate_lock. Like this: EXT4-fs error (device sda) in ext4_setattr:5557: Out of memory INFO: task fsstress:374 blocked for more than 122 seconds. Not tainted 6.14.0-rc1-next-20250206-xfstests-dirty #726 "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message. task:fsstress state:D stack:0 pid:374 tgid:374 ppid:373 task_flags:0x440140 flags:0x00000000 Call Trace: <TASK> __schedule+0x2c9/0x7f0 schedule+0x27/0xa0 schedule_preempt_disabled+0x15/0x30 rwsem_down_read_slowpath+0x278/0x4c0 down_read+0x59/0xb0 page_cache_ra_unbounded+0x65/0x1b0 filemap_get_pages+0x124/0x3e0 filemap_read+0x114/0x3d0 vfs_read+0x297/0x360 ksys_read+0x6c/0xe0 do_syscall_64+0x4b/0x110 entry_SYSCALL_64_after_hwframe+0x76/0x7e

Reserved 2024-12-29 | Published 2025-04-16 | Updated 2025-05-26 | Assigner Linux

Product status

Default status
unaffected

93011887013dbaa0e3a0285176ca89be153df651 before 551667f99bcf04fa58594d7d19aef73c861a1200
affected

b6ce2dbe984bcd7fb0c1df15b5e2fa57e1574a8e before 45314999f950321a341033ae8f9ac12dce40669b
affected

c7fc0366c65628fd69bfc310affec4918199aae2 before 32d872e3905746ff1048078256cb00f946b97d8a
affected

c7fc0366c65628fd69bfc310affec4918199aae2 before 7e91ae31e2d264155dfd102101afc2de7bd74a64
affected

Default status
affected

6.13
affected

Any version before 6.13
unaffected

6.6.89
unaffected

6.12.26
unaffected

6.14.2
unaffected

6.15
unaffected

References

git.kernel.org/...c/551667f99bcf04fa58594d7d19aef73c861a1200

git.kernel.org/...c/45314999f950321a341033ae8f9ac12dce40669b

git.kernel.org/...c/32d872e3905746ff1048078256cb00f946b97d8a

git.kernel.org/...c/7e91ae31e2d264155dfd102101afc2de7bd74a64

cve.org (CVE-2025-22120)

nvd.nist.gov (CVE-2025-22120)

Download JSON

Share this page
https://cve.threatint.eu/CVE/CVE-2025-22120

Support options

Helpdesk Chat, Email, Knowledgebase